### Company Overview
Established in 2022, Due is a London-based fintech startup with a vision to reshape international payments through blockchain and stablecoin innovations. The company provides borderless multi-currency accounts, global transfers/remittances and merchant acquiring for individuals and businesses.
Due built its platform on top of public blockchains, leveraging stablecoin liquidity markets across Europe, US, LatAm and Africa to enable accessible, fast, and cheap international money movements for clients around the world. Due’s platform is non-custodial, meaning the clients always have full control of, and direct access to, their assets on public blockchains without the involvement of intermediaries.
Due [raised $3.3m](https://www.theblock.co/post/261848/payment-startup-due-raises-3-3-million-in-seed-to-develop-blockchain-based-platform) in a seed funding round led by Semantic and Fabric Venture, with the participation from BlockTower, Speedinvest, Polymorphic Capital, and Discovery Ventures.
